基于虚拟仪器技术的弹丸初速测量系统
引用本文:王昭,王昌明,吴平信,姜守全,狄长安.基于虚拟仪器技术的弹丸初速测量系统[J].南京理工大学学报(自然科学版),2003,27(1):48-51.
作者姓名:王昭  王昌明  吴平信  姜守全  狄长安
作者单位:南京理工大机械工程学院,南京,210094
摘    要:介绍一种基于虚拟仪器技术的弹丸初速测量系统,阐明系统工作原理,实现方法及系统的硬件和软件结构,利用小波变换空间局部化性质,探讨小波变换模极大值检测信号突变点的方法在确定天幕靶弹丸信号特征点的应用,大量实验表明了该系统的可行性及实用性。

关 键 词:虚拟仪器  弹丸初速测量系统  速度测量  小波变换  天幕靶

The Measurement System of Projectiles Initial Velocity Based on Virtual Instrument Technology
WangZhao WangChangming WuPingxin,JiangShouquan DiChang''''an.The Measurement System of Projectiles Initial Velocity Based on Virtual Instrument Technology[J].Journal of Nanjing University of Science and Technology(Nature Science),2003,27(1):48-51.
Authors:WangZhao WangChangming WuPingxin  JiangShouquan DiChang'an
Abstract:A measurement system was introduced about initial speed of projectiles based on virtual instrument technology.It stated the operating principle,method of implementation,the hardware and software structure.The wavelet transform was used to perform local analysis in space,and an abrupt change could be detected by model maximum of wavelet transform,the feature point of signal was gotten when projectile passed through sky screen optical target.Experiments proved the feasibility and practicability of the system.
Keywords:projectiles  velocity measurement  instrument  wavelet transform
